American households can now order up to eight more at home rapid COVID-19 tests free of charge, the White House announced Tuesday. Officials said they were expanding the offering of free, at-home, COVID-19 tests—which cost around $10 each—to help 'slow the spread of the virus'. The offer brings the total number of free tests offered to each American household to 16—with the latest offer double that from the first two rounds. President Joe Biden has committed to making a billion Covid tests available to the public free of charge, including 500 million through the United States Postal Service. American families are shelling out what amounts to $5,000 per year to put gas in their cars—a painful increase from $2,800 just a year ago, according to a new report. The new study by Yardeni Research shows the ever-increasing financial burden borne by US households in recent months as the price of fuel has reached record levels. In March, the annual rate of gasoline spending by US households was at $3,800, according to the study. “No wonder that the Consumer Sentiment Index is so depressed. The wonder is that retail sales have been so surprisingly strong during April and May,” Yardeni said in a note.

Two children have been hospitalized in Tennessee after their parents could not find a specific type of formula amid a nationwide shortage. Both children have intestinal disorders that make it difficult for them to absorb nutrients. They were treated at Le Bonheur Children’s Hospital in Memphis after their bodies couldn’t tolerate an alternate type of formula, according to Fox13 Memphis. One of the children was released Tuesday. Dr. Mark Corkins, a pediatric gastroenterologist who treated the children, told Fox13 he gave them IV fluids and nutrients while they search for the formula, though it is not a long-term solution and he expects more kids will land in hospitals.

Netflix is cutting about 150 jobs after announcing that it's lost 200,000 subscribers since the end of last year. Most of the employees being laid off are based in the US and work in creative positions across film and TV. The California-based streaming service is even eliminating some executive positions in its original content departments, sources told Deadline. A few director-level executives may also be on their way out. The news comes a month after the company reported that its global subscriber base declined in the first quarter of 2022. It expects to lose another two million subscribers by next quarter, Fortune reports.
